Mister Softee
There are things that my children will never understand about the life I have lived, but I often attempt to introduce my children to parts of my childhood through story telling. These revelations, at times, don’t always work out well. And such was the case, as I tried to describe the pure momentary joy I experienced as a kid when “Mr. Softee” served up his uncomplicated pleasures to the youth of our neighborhood. It is hard to describe the giddiness I felt when the tinkling notes of “Mr. Softee’s” bewitching truck called to me. The questioning looks, from my offspring, cast in my direction sting. It is obvious they are trying to comprehend our parents letting kids jog blissfully to the painted caravan. Their bewildered stares stem from the guarded era that they have endured. I worry that the memories of a life of simplicity I was allowed to enjoy will be forgotten. It is hard to describe to them the adventurous fun of couch diving for wayward coins to afford the sweet treats offered by “Mr. Softee”. Luxury is a state of mind. Memories of soft served cones dipped in chocolate or sprinkles, served to you by a man in a cardboard hat bending out of two foot window, are priceless.
